| superchunk said: huh, how is $10 worth less than $250 before taxes? |
Not in the eyes of a poker player.
When you don't have overwhelming odds the only time you should enter a bet is when your likely odds beat the invesment needed to win the "pot" and usually by a decent amount.
Since the "Pot" a Wii = 250... and it costs $10 for a 1 in 45 shot...
$450>$250 makes it a bad bet.
